Greek[edit]

Etymology[edit]

From Ancient Greek κλώθω (klṓthō), from κάλαθος (kálathos).

Verb[edit]

κλώθω (klótho) (past έκλωσα, passive κλώθομαι)

  1. to spin (wool, cotton, etc)
